The funding outlined for First Nations is dramatically insufficient to address the urgent needs address in critical infrastructure gaps across the Alberta region, particularly around clean water. This budget fails to deliver on reconciliation promises and is the continuation of unjust differences in living conditions for First Nations.<\/strong>\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>\u00a0<strong>\u201cPrime Minister Mark Carney\u2019s first budget is just fancy words on status quo,\u201d says Chief Troy Knowlton, Piikani Nation, Treaty 7 Territory. \u201cThe funding for clean water and infrastructure is simply maintaining progress on active projects\u2014including those focused on water advisories\u2014among hundreds of others. It\u2019s a single drop in the giant bucket that Canada created.\u201d<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><strong style=\"font-size: 16px;\">The budget\u2019s allocations for critical infrastructure are a mere fraction of the hundreds of billions required to close the documented gap by the 2030 deadline set by Indigenous Services Canada. Relying on piecemeal, time-limited funding continues the colonial legacy, preventing First Nations from achieving true autonomy and long-term economic planning.<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><strong>\u201cAs we have seen time and again, the Government of Canada is unwilling to follow through on the promises and legal duties they are required to fulfill,\u201d says Chief Sheldon Sunshine, Sturgeon Lake Cree Nation, Treaty 8 territory. \u201cThis budget does nothing to meaningfully close the enormous gaps that exist, or further First Nations in their road to reconciliation.
